S. Pope Francisco Leave a legacy of progress in Inclusion of women In prominent jobs inside Catholic Church. In 2013, when Argentina was elected, women formed 19.2 % of the Vatican employees. After a decade, they rose to 23.4 %.
A survey conducted by the Vatican News in 2023 revealed that the number of employees working in Santa C and the Vatican city administration jumped from 846 to 1165 in the first ten years of Pontef Francisco.
At the time of the survey, the Apostolic Chair used 3114 people, including 812 women. In practice, this means that one of every four employees was a woman.

In January 2021, the Pope created a change in the law of the ecclesiastical – the Church’s List – to allow women during the mass to read the Bible and distribute the company – to provide two hosts.
Francisco reviewed the old document issued by Pope Paul VI (1972), which determined that men alone can obtain the ministries of the reader and acceptance, representing the institutional character to the usual practice.
Women vote for the first time in the bishops
In February 2021, the Pope appointed the French religious Nathalie becquart as an agent of the Synod of the bishops, becoming the first woman to vote in the Singo Society. It was a historical teacher to open the doors for more transformations.
In 2023, Francisco strengthened major changes in the role of women in the church. That year, the ink allowed women to vote for the first time in a global bishop.
Before these changes, women can only participate as reviews, without voting on the final text that summarizes the approved instructions at the top.
The sixteenth general assembly of Sinodes bishops was held in two sessions, the first in October 2023 and the second in October 2024.
According to the Italian newspaper Avvenire, the members of the Senodes 365 were in total, i.e. 364 in addition to the ink. Of these, 54 women. Others were 85, including 27 women.
In that edition, the approved document highlighted the Vatican initiatives to expand the space and participation of women in ecclesiastical structures. The last text said that “there are no reasons that prevent women from taking leadership roles in the church.”
The appointment of women in leadership positions
In 2021, Pope Francis was first appointed Amin, the Italian religious Smandra, who began to act in Decker to serve integrated human development. This was the highest position ever by a woman at the time.
Since then, Francis has renewed the church structure when, in 2022, the Evangelium Constitution has been established on the Roman Korea, the central government of the Catholic Church.
The new document for women enabled the direction of Decker, equivalent to the ministry. Thus, women can become municipal heads, a position that the Cardinals and bishops cannot carry in the past.
However, in January 2025, Francisco also appointed the first woman to head one of the most relevant departments in the Vatican.
Brambilla Nun was chosen to lead the finest to the institutes of devoted life and the Apostolic Life Associations, responsible for supervising the Catholic religious orders around the world. She became the first mayor in the Vatican.
From March 1, 2025, Franciscan Denella Rafaella Petrini began holding the position of Chairman of the Pap for the Vatican city, as well as the head of governance. Her appointment was already announced by Francis on January 19 of the same year.
For 12 years of papacy, Francisco attributed other positions. During this time, they began to occupy the “second driving” jobs in various Vatican offices, such as development, family life and the press.
In 2017, for the first time, Francisco also appointed a woman to direct the Vatican museums, Italian historian Barbara Gata.
Among the women who hold great related positions in the Vatican, the Brazilian journalist Christian Murray. Since 2019, she has been running the official of the official press room, which was also appointed by Francisco.
